Different Problems, Different Tools

Comparing these two is like comparing a drill to a screwdriver. An email finder takes a name and company, then returns a deliverable address. An email verifier takes addresses you've already collected and tells you which ones are safe to send to - running syntax checks, domain verification, inbox pinging, spam trap detection, and catch-all identification.

Clearalist doesn't find emails. GetProspect is primarily an email finder, with verification included in its plans. They're complementary, not competitors.

Clearalist at a Glance

Clearalist is a straightforward bulk email verifier. Upload a list, run validation, get back a cleaned file sorted by status. It claims 98%+ accuracy on verification results, includes catch-all detection, and offers credits that never expire - pay once, use whenever. A recent update introduced 40% lower credit usage per verification, and you get 500 free credits to start.

Here's the thing, though: Clearalist has almost no third-party review presence. No G2 rating we could find, no Trustpilot page, and no Reddit discussion in our research. That doesn't mean the tool is bad - plenty of solid niche products fly under the radar - but you're leaning heavily on vendor-reported accuracy numbers when your sender reputation is at stake. That's a gamble we'd want more social proof to feel comfortable with.

GetProspect at a Glance

GetProspect is an email finder built around an 18M-contact database with access to a 900M-member professional network. It ships with a Chrome extension, CRM integrations for HubSpot, Salesforce, and Pipedrive, Google Sheets integration, API access, and basic built-in verification.

Users generally like it. It holds a 4.0/5 on G2 across 41 reviews and a 4.2/5 on Trustpilot with 9 reviews, with praise for ease of use and fast list building. Credits roll over for one month, and you aren't charged for duplicates - a meaningful perk for bulk users.

But accuracy is a real problem. In a Reddit benchmark testing 8 email finders on the same 2,500 contacts, GetProspect returned just 64.6% valid emails. Roughly 1 in 3 bounced. On top of that, 9% of G2 reviewers gave it 1 star, some Trustpilot reviews flag confusing quota systems, and users on r/gdpr have raised questions about data sourcing practices.

Let's be honest: GetProspect is fine for quick prospecting on a budget. But if you're sending more than a few hundred cold emails a month, that 35% bounce rate will torch your domain reputation faster than any savings justify.

Based on Clearalist's published per-credit rates, here's how costs shake out:

Volume Clearalist GetProspect
~50 emails Free (from 500 free credits) Free
~1,000 emails ~$5 (2,500-credit tier) $49/mo
~5,000 emails ~$22.50 (5,000-credit tier) $99/mo
~50,000 emails ~$150 (50,000-credit tier) $399/mo

At 10,000 verifications, Clearalist runs about $0.004 per email as a one-time purchase. GetProspect's effective cost depends on the plan: Starter is $49 for 1,000 valid emails per month (~$0.049 each), Growth 5K is $99 for 5,000 (~$0.02 each), and Growth 50K is $399 for 50,000 (~$0.008 each). But Clearalist only verifies. If you're paying for both tools, you're managing two workflows and two budgets.

One detail worth knowing: GetProspect also sells standalone verification credit packs - 10,000 for $29, 25,000 for $39. If you're already on GetProspect for finding, those packs might eliminate the need for Clearalist entirely.

FAQ

Can I use Clearalist and GetProspect together?

Yes - find with GetProspect, verify with Clearalist. But running two tools means double the cost and added workflow friction. GetProspect's own verification credit packs (10K for $29) are a simpler alternative if you're already on their platform.

Is GetProspect accurate enough to skip verification?

No. Its 64.6% valid rate in independent testing means roughly 1 in 3 emails bounce. Always verify before sending. Your sender reputation isn't worth the gamble.

Does Clearalist find email addresses?

No. Clearalist is strictly a verification and list cleaning tool. It validates addresses you already have but can't discover new ones. You'll need a separate email finder for prospecting.
